Transaction c590d750346848738ffdf7664f4fb276ea2dc2671cf472ca9205a034ce5ae6c6

1 Input
2 Outputs
  • c590d750346848738ffdf7664f4fb276ea2dc2671cf472ca9205a034ce5ae6c6:0
  • value  7616
    address  1EHZxAYq7Eg65dFy17ghYHmNmeyhK1hVuJ
  • c590d750346848738ffdf7664f4fb276ea2dc2671cf472ca9205a034ce5ae6c6:1
  • value  1148585
    address  38yWwX44M7Jis5oojwd7wRfBgy4xYJxmG6